The kitchens are large so it makes it fairly easy to cook with lots of people staying. The beds were comfortable. I liked the history on the walls that you could read & to see the room they’ve kept historically accurate. People seemed to be making good use of the games room
It is a little way out of the centre so it’s good to make use of the public transport but the walk into town is pleasant. It did give the vibe that it maybe wasn’t in the nicest area of the city but nothing bad happened whilst I was there. The bathrooms are a little tricky to get ready in, just due to the space but it’s a converted prison so all part of the experience!

What a fabulous concept to build a hostel in an old prison! I chose here initially for the amazing uniqueness of it all and I really enjoyed my stay. The hostel really leans into the prison history and has this themed throughout its checkin process and the property itself with some of the rooms kept as was so you can walk in and see the beds the residents used and their true life graffiti on the walls of their cell which was surreal and fantastic at the same time! There is on site parking but it is first come first served and there were lots of cars. I managed to nab the last spot - phew - but looks like there is also a lot of free nearby street parking as well which also looks fairly safe and close. The rooms are basic bunk rooms with about 4 to a "cell" and a small locker for valuables. I was there 1 night in a 4 bed female dorm and found it to be cosy, good value for money and fitting all my needs adequately. Location wise you are quite far from the centre - 30-40 minute walk or a 10 minute drive - but if you don't mind that this is quite nice and unique stay. Staff are very friendly and helpful and overall I got a great vibe and would have stayed longer if it fit my itinerary. Would recommend!
Some of the toilets are squished into stalls without that much leg space so worth bearing in mind when heading in there as if you have long legs you might struggle.
